This is an automated email from the ASF dual-hosted git repository.
chamikara pushed a commit to branch transform_service_test_suite
in repository https://gitbox.apache.org/repos/asf/beam.git
The following commit(s) were added to refs/heads/transform_service_test_suite
by this push:
new 7f2ca952127 updates
7f2ca952127 is described below
commit 7f2ca9521278e63180af4177fc87b76f800bab5a
Author: Chamikara Jayalath <[email protected]>
AuthorDate: Wed Mar 6 00:01:54 2024 -0800
updates
---
.../transformservice/launcher/TransformServiceLauncher.java | 3 ++-
.../apache_beam/runners/portability/expansion_service_main.py | 2 +-
sdks/python/expansion-service-container/boot.go | 11 ++++++++++-
3 files changed, 13 insertions(+), 3 deletions(-)
diff --git
a/sdks/java/transform-service/launcher/src/main/java/org/apache/beam/sdk/transformservice/launcher/TransformServiceLauncher.java
b/sdks/java/transform-service/launcher/src/main/java/org/apache/beam/sdk/transformservice/launcher/TransformServiceLauncher.java
index c0a9097a762..a61cfc4ffce 100644
---
a/sdks/java/transform-service/launcher/src/main/java/org/apache/beam/sdk/transformservice/launcher/TransformServiceLauncher.java
+++
b/sdks/java/transform-service/launcher/src/main/java/org/apache/beam/sdk/transformservice/launcher/TransformServiceLauncher.java
@@ -131,7 +131,8 @@ public class TransformServiceLauncher {
File dependenciesDir = Paths.get(tmpDir, "dependencies_dir").toFile();
Path updatedRequirementsFilePath = Paths.get(dependenciesDir.toString(),
"requirements.txt");
if (dependenciesDir.exists()) {
- LOG.info("Reusing the existing dependencies directory " +
dependenciesDir.getAbsolutePath());
+ throw new RuntimeException("xyz123 Dependencies dir " +
dependenciesDir.toString() + " exists.");
+ // LOG.info("Reusing the existing dependencies directory " +
dependenciesDir.getAbsolutePath());
} else {
LOG.info(
"Creating a temporary directory for storing dependencies: "
diff --git
a/sdks/python/apache_beam/runners/portability/expansion_service_main.py
b/sdks/python/apache_beam/runners/portability/expansion_service_main.py
index 063e4406e65..5dcd1429cbe 100644
--- a/sdks/python/apache_beam/runners/portability/expansion_service_main.py
+++ b/sdks/python/apache_beam/runners/portability/expansion_service_main.py
@@ -55,7 +55,7 @@ def main(argv):
print(dir_list)
print2 = "******** xyz123 Files and directories in '" + path + "' :" +
str(dir_list)
- raise Exception(print1 + " " + print2)
+# raise Exception(print1 + " " + print2)
parser = argparse.ArgumentParser()
parser.add_argument(
diff --git a/sdks/python/expansion-service-container/boot.go
b/sdks/python/expansion-service-container/boot.go
index 22a228381ba..983541d6bf3 100644
--- a/sdks/python/expansion-service-container/boot.go
+++ b/sdks/python/expansion-service-container/boot.go
@@ -157,7 +157,13 @@ func launchExpansionServiceProcess() error {
return fmt.Errorf("Could not execute /usr/bin/ls -al /: %s",
err)
}
-// if *requirements_file != "" {
+// if _, err := os.Stat(*requirements_file); errors.Is(err, os.ErrNotExist) {
+// requirement_file_exists = false
+// } else {
+// requirement_file_exists = true
+// }
+//
+// if requirement_file_exists {
// log.Printf("Received the requirements file %v",
*requirements_file)
// updatedRequirementsFileName, err :=
getUpdatedRequirementsFile(*requirements_file, *dependencies_dir)
// if err != nil {
@@ -173,7 +179,10 @@ func launchExpansionServiceProcess() error {
// if err != nil {
// return err
// }
+// } else if (*requirements_file) {
+// log.Printf("Requirements file %s was provided but not available.",
*requirements_file)
// }
+
if err := execx.Execute(pythonVersion, args...); err != nil {
log.Printf("****** xyz123 could not start the expansion service: %s",
err)
return fmt.Errorf("could not start the expansion service: %s",
err)